For the development of navigation, flood control, irrigation, and hydropower
Explanation:
The main reason dams and canals were built in Washington in the early 1900s was "for the development of navigation, flood control, irrigation, and hydropower."
This is evident in the fact that in 1925 when the US Congress approved the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ers and the Federal Power Commission to jointly "...prepare and submit to Congress an estimate of the cost of making such examinations, surveys or other investigations... for efficient development of the potential water power, the control of floods and the needs of irrigation."
The report was eventually realized during the Franklin D. Roosevelt administration as the United States president

1. Party system: It is referred to as the interactions of parties with each other.
2. Election: Means by which people choose their officials.
3. Recall: A method by which an elective local official may be removed from office during his term.
4. Suffrage: It is the right and obligation to vote of qualified citizens in the election of public officers.
5. Political party: It is any group providing label upon which candidates run for public offices.
6. Representation: The capacity to respond and to articulate the views of both members and voters.
7. Persons disqualified to vote: Those declared as insane or incompetent person.
8. Plebiscite: Is the vote of the people expressing their choice for or against a proposed law submitted to them.
9. The one-party system: Only one political party holds power either because it towers above the others or because it suppresses all other groups.

Robert E. Lee was the head of the Confederate army during the Civil War between 1861 and 1865. Although he was not in favor of slavery, and even President Lincoln had offered him command of the Union army, Lee decided to remain loyal to his native state, Virginia, and join the Confederate cause, leading the southern forces, which were worse composed than those of the north, to fight on all fronts and put the Union army in trouble.

What caused the global depression? Who is at fault?
Answer:
While the October 1929 stock market crash triggered the Great Depression, multiple factors turned it into a decade-long economic catastrophe. Overproduction, executive inaction, ill-timed tariffs, and an inexperienced Federal Reserve all contributed to the Great Depression.

The Nuremberg Laws were a set of norms that were passed during the seventh annual congress of the German National Socialist Party, held on September 15, 1935, in the German city of Nuremberg. These laws were established to protect the lineages of German blood, the Aryan race, and the honor of the German people. Therefore, these laws were enacted to mark the distance between the Jewish people and the German people. These laws stand out for having highly discriminatory mandates towards the Jewish people. In May 1985, Gorbachev gave a speech in Leningrad in which he admitted the slowing of economic development, and inadequate living standards. ... Gorbachev and his team of economic advisors then introduced more fundamental reforms, which became known as perestroika (restructuring).
The policies which were known as perestroika and glasnost was introduced by Mikhail Gorbachev in the late 1980's because he believed that the Soviet Union was facing serious economic and social problems.
What was glasnost?The policy of glasnost was aim of promoting greater transparency and public participation in Soviet society. Gorbachev sought to lift restrictions on freedom of speech and the press, as well as allow greater political and social expression.
This involved allowing more public debate and criticism, promoting cultural and intellectual exchange with the West, and acknowledging past mistakes and abuses of power.
Mikhail Gorbachev introduced the policies of perestroika and glasnost, so that greater openness and transparency would help to build trust and confidence within Soviet society.

What did the Sedition Act allow the US government to do?
Answer:
he Sedition Act of 1918 curtailed the free speech rights of U.S. citizens during time of war. Passed on May 16, 1918, as an amendment to Title I of the Espionage Act of 1917, the act provided for further and expanded limitations on speech.
